On 11/02/2010 02:00 AM, Stefano Sabatini wrote:
> The problem with libmpcodecs is that it isn't a library, and was never
> meant to be usable from outside MPlayer, so trying to integrate it
> into FFmpeg is a nightmare. Indeed the only way is to copy the files
> to FFmpeg and all the dependencies (vf.h, mp_msg.h, help_mp.h,
> m_option.h, m_struct.h, img_format.h, mp_image.h, mpc_info.h, vfcap.h
> etc) and somehow patch it to the build system...  and yet I have no
> idea how I can map the MPlayer log system to that of FFmpeg and looks
> more that I can withstand...

Better put a doc about converting them by doing it for one and then have
more people do the port following the guide.
